Penang Celebrates Global Oral Healthcare Leadership at 10th ICDXV & WSI International Conference Opening Ceremony

GEORGE TOWN, 18 April 2025The 10th International College of Dentists (ICD) Section XV and World Stomatology Institute (WSI) International Conference and Induction Ceremony was hosted at the Setia SPICE Convention Centre this morning. The highly anticipated event drew dental professionals, healthcare leaders, policymakers, and international delegates from over a dozen countries, marking a significant milestone in the region’s healthcare and medical tourism calendar.

Graced by Penang Chief Minister YAB Tuan Chow Kon Yeow, the ceremony officially launched the three-day global gathering, which places a spotlight on the future of oral healthcare, with this year’s theme “New Era of Digital AI Technology in Medicine and Dentistry.”

In his opening speech, Chow welcomed delegates from near and far, expressing Penang’s pride in hosting such a prestigious event. “This conference reflects the power of international collaboration in shaping the future of healthcare — not just in ideas but in tangible action,” he said, addressing a packed ballroom of local and international attendees.

The Chief Minister spoke proudly about the promising future AI brings to dentistry, envisioning real-time diagnostics, tele-dentistry, and mobile care as accessible tools that could bridge the healthcare gap, especially in Malaysia’s rural and underserved communities. “It’s not science fiction anymore; it’s here. And it can revolutionize how we deliver care across the country,” he said.

However, Chow also addressed pressing challenges within the sector, including the uneven distribution of dental practitioners and the growing concern of young graduates facing limited career placements in the public sector. He emphasized the importance of balanced national priorities, urging equal investment in healthcare sciences alongside STEM fields like engineering and IT. “We must rebalance our priorities if we truly want to build a resilient, future-ready healthcare system,” he declared.

The opening ceremony was also attended by YB Wong Hon Wai, Penang State Executive Councillor for Tourism and Creative Economy; Adjunct Professor Dato’ Dr. How Kim Chuan, Organizing Chairman and President of ICD Section XV and WSI; and Mr. Ashwin Gunasekeran, CEO of the Penang Convention & Exhibition Bureau (PCEB), along with leaders from Malaysia’s top universities, international dental associations, and key sponsors.

In his remarks, Adjunct Professor Dato’ Dr. How Kim Chuan acknowledged the significance of uniting ICD and WSI on a single platform. “This conference is more than an academic gathering — it’s a declaration of unity, excellence, and progressive thinking. Penang is an ideal host, offering both heritage and innovation,” he shared.

The morning also featured a symbolic group photo session on stage with the Chief Minister and dignitaries, followed by a lively media Q&A session. Delegates praised the state’s commitment to fostering international partnerships and supporting continued professional education in oral healthcare.

Mr. Ashwin Gunasekeran reinforced Penang’s position as a sought-after destination for international conferences. “Events like this are about more than healthcare; they benefit our creative economy, hotels, and international image. We’re proud to welcome the world here to Penang,” he said.

Today’s opening marked the start of an event-packed program that will continue over the next two days, featuring plenary sessions by over 30 international speakers, scientific competitions, exhibitions, hands-on workshops, and two grand induction ceremonies. Special recognitions such as the ICD Honorary Fellowship and WSI Founding Fellow Awards are set to be presented to distinguished global leaders in oral health.

As the conference unfolds, it is expected to spark vital conversations, forge new partnerships, and spotlight Penang as a dynamic hub for healthcare innovation and knowledge exchange.
